Stainless steel toll booths are built using high-grade materials to ensure longevity and reliability. Below is a sample material specification table:
| Component | Material | Specification | Purpose |
|---|---|---|---|
| Exterior Panels | 304 Stainless Steel | 2mm thickness | Durability and corrosion resistance |
| Roof | 316 Stainless Steel | 2.5mm thickness | Weatherproofing and long-term reliability |
| Windows | Tempered Glass | 6mm thickness | Security and visibility |
| Flooring | Stainless Steel Sheet with Anti-Slip Coating | 3mm thickness | Safety and durability |

Q1: How long does a stainless steel toll booth last?
A: With proper maintenance, stainless steel toll booths can last 15-20 years, depending on environmental conditions.
